Our Security Installation Specialists play a crucial role in ensuring the safety and efficiency of our Smart Buildings. This involves ensuring the installation, programming, start-up, and commissioning of state-of-the-art integrated security systems (IP cameras/CCTV, alarm sensors, access control devices, and software platforms) are handled timely and accurately. This position supports our Solutions team, which handles new construction and retrofit projects in commercial buildings such as hospitals, universities, data centers, and industrial facilities. In addition to the primary responsibilities, this position acts as a mentor, providing on-the-job training to less experienced Specialists, fostering a culture of growth and knowledge-sharing within our team. As a Senior Security Installation Specialist, you will:

Participate in Operational Testing, Verification, and Acceptance

Run routine reports to review system operation

Participate in final inspection and testing

Support customer acceptance

Assist with customer training on system operations

Complete and submit routine written reports

Identify code and non-conformance issues and make recommendations for system installation

Conduct Project Site Communication and Coordination

May support others in the scheduling of trade contractors to coordinate start-up services as needed

Qualifications

Basic Qualifications: 5+ years’ experience in the installation and/or maintenance of large-scale integrated Security Systems, including access control, IP video cameras, intrusion, and surveillance

Understanding of network components, workstation and server operating system management, IP addressing and subnetting, IP video network transmission, factors that impact video rates and quality, as well as basic switch, router, and firewall principles

Ability to work in a variety of environments around mechanical equipment, including climbing ladders, scaffolds, and high-lift equipment; working in ducts, above ceilings, and in outside/inside/heat/cold/day/night conditions; use of hand tools, laptop, email, smartphone, and tablet; ability to differentiate types/colors of wire, and lift up to 50 pounds unassisted

Must be willing and available to participate in an on-call rotation with other Specialists

Legally authorized to work in the United States on a continual and permanent basis without company sponsorship

Must be at least 21 years of age and possess a valid driver’s license with limited violations; must meet eligibility requirements to participate in Siemens' fleet vehicle program

Preferred (not required) Qualifications: High school diploma

8+ years’ experience in the installation and/or maintenance of large-scale integrated security systems

Massachusetts Class D Electrical License

Ability to read/understand design and construction documents
